The Poales is an order of plants in the Class Liliopsida (monocots) of the flowering plants. Included in the order is the Family Poaceae (grasses) and their allies. This group basically corresponds to the Order Restionales in Cronquist's (1981) classification, except that he placed the grasses in the Order Cyperales. Since then it has generally been agreed that the Poaceae belong here, however, and in fact a few authors have removed the Restionaceae instead.

Otherwise the composition of the order has been fairly stable. By far, the most economically important family is the Poaceae — the grass or corn family, which includes barley, maize, millet, rice, and wheat.
